SU056 is a YB-1 inhibitor. SU056 induces cell-cycle arrest, apoptosis, and inhibits cell migration in ovarian cancer cells. SU056 interacts with YB-1 and inhibits and its associated downstream proteins and pathways. SU056 can enhance the cytotoxic effects of Paclitaxel (HY-B0015).IC50 & Target:YB-1In Vitro:SU056 (0-10 μM approximately, 48 h) inhibits cell growth in OVCAR3/4/5/8, SKOV3 and ID8 cells。
SU056 (1 μM, 5-8 days) inhibits colony formation in a dose-dependent manner in OVCAR-8 and ID8 cells。
SU056 (1-5 μM, 6 h) arrests OVCAR8, SKOV3, and ID8 cells in the sub-G1 and G1 phases.
SU056 (0-1 μM, 12 h) inhibits cell migration in OVCAR8, SKOV3, and ID8 cells.
SU056 (0-5 μM, 24 h) induces apoptotic cell death in OVCAR8, SKOV3, and ID8 cells.
SU056 (1-5 μM, 12 h) inhibited the expression of YB-1, TMSB10, SUMO2, and PMSB2 proteins in OVCAR8 cells.
SU056 (0.1, 0.5, and 1 μM, 48 h) enhances the cytotoxic effects of Paclitaxel (HY-B0015) (0.1, 0.5, and 1 nM).
In Vivo:SU056 (20 mg/kg, i.p.) inhibits tumor growth in mice implanted with ID8 cells.
SU056 (10 mg/kg, i.p., daily) combined with Paclitaxel (HY-B0015) (5 mg/kg, weekly, i.p.) shows a much greater reduction in OC tumor growth in immunodeficiency mice implanted with OVCAR8 OC tumors.
